About Culvers kids meal

Culver’s Kids Meals deliver a tasty, kid-friendly dining option inspired by American comfort food. Each meal includes a choice of classic favorites such as a ButterBurger, Grilled Cheese, or Chicken Tenders, paired with a side like crinkle-cut fries or applesauce, and a small drink. The meals emphasize fresh ingredients, such as never-frozen Midwest beef and hand-battered chicken. Healthier choices like applesauce and milk provide balanced alternatives to fries and soda, catering to diverse dietary needs. While items like fries and burgers are indulgent treats, Culver’s also focuses on portion-controlled servings tailored for kids to enjoy responsibly. Each meal comes with a bonus – a token for a free scoop of Culver's signature fresh frozen custard, offering a sweet finish. Culver’s Kids Meals blend hearty flavors and family-friendly values while allowing parents to mix and match options for a balanced approach to dining.
